Reuben CHAMPION was born 4 September 1727 in Lyme, Crown Colony of Connecticut
Reuben CHAMPION was the child of Stephen CHAMPION and Deborah BROCKWAYReuben had an active role in U.S. Revolutionary War.
Tracing Ancestors Through Military Service Records: Unveiling Family Heroes
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):
Reuben married Lydia DUNCAN . The couple had (at least) 1 child.
Lydia DUNCAN was born 22 September 1730 in Old Saybrook, Connecticut, USA (Saybrook Colony). Lydia died 1 May 1809 in Longmeadow, Massachusetts, USA.
Reuben CHAMPION died 29 March 1777 in Fort Ticonderoga, Essex, Crown Colony of New York.
